Owen the latest Red Devil to join Sheffield

James Gordon

Salford hooker Gareth Owen has signed for Sheffield on a season-long loan.

Owen, 21, follows Will Hope and Jon Ford from the Red Devils to the Eagles for the 2014 season.

He said: “I’m excited to be joining the Eagles. They had a great season last year, winning the Championship for a second successive year and I hope I can help them defend the trophy again in 2014.”

Owen joined Salford back in 2010, and has made 36 appearances in Super League, scoring six tries.

Eagles coach Mark Aston said: “I’m delighted we have managed to bring in Gareth for the season.

“He has a number of first team appearances under his belt at Salford and will bring with him that Super League mentality.

“He began training with us last night (Wednesday) and wants to develop his game which I’m sure if he keeps the right attitude and determination he will do.

“We now have competition for places right across the squad. Nobody’s place is certain and everyone will have to train hard and play well to keep their place.”
